Solen Photography create modern, natural, relaxed wedding and elopement photography for creative couples across Scotland.

Artist | Photographer | Elopement Enthusiast

I’ve been a full-time Scottish wedding and elopement photographer for over a decade, travelling up and down the country and a little beyond. I use analogue film cameras (35mm and medium format) along with digital. We’re after fun, relaxed, authentic and stylish images full of joyful candid moments. I’m based in Edinburgh where I also help couples to design local elopements and small-scale weddings using all the best local independent creatives and small brands (the elopement society but sssh, it’s a secret, visit the Elopement Enthusiast section of my website for the lowdown).

I love collaborating with creative couples and most of my clients tend to be camera shy, a bit awkward, looking for a stress-free experience while being centre stage. I’m very much happier behind the camera than in front (the faces I pull, ooooft) so I get it and do my best to put you at ease and to creep around in the background being as unobtrusive as possible for most of the day.

I’m one of the many late diagnosed neurodivergent folks of my generation realising we’re creative and a bit messy for a reason! Photography has always been a way to be present, to quiet my scattered brains and hyperfocus on the ebb and flow of the day, the patterns of light and the shared emotions.

When I’m not shooting weddings or portraits with local brands, I’m working on collaborative art projects which I’m trying to build time for. I love creative play, I think it’s as important as our connections to each other. And with each new exhibition, commission or collaborative project I feel I’m learning more which informs my commercial photography work too. Getting in the darkroom (cupboard!), music on, counting the exposure is quiet bliss.

My advice for engaged couples planning their big/small days – forget traditions that don’t suit you, let’s create something that feels personal and authentic to you, that tells your story. No cringe posing, just your natural connection captured to keep safe. I won’t steal you away from guests for hours, it’s a day to celebrate with them and to grab lots of lovely photos of them having fun times too.

I photograph what happens – an artistic candid documentary of what your celebrations really felt like. All the joy and emotions, the quiet wee moments, the drunken unlikely new pals. Letting go of perfection and prioritising fun. Beachy tones and strong black and white edits. Intimate, stylish and delicious memories capturing the flow and vibes of the day.

“I discovered Solen through my job, and I’ve known for years that I wanted her to be our wedding photographer because of how much I loved her work. Solen was such a joy to have on our team throughout the whole process. She has a really helpful online questionnaire, which is mainly for her to understand what you want of course, but we actually found it really useful as a framework for figuring out what we needed to consider too. Not knowing what’s expected is one of the biggest frustrations of wedding planning but Solen was always ready with answers. She was also a master at helping two introverts get excited for a day of being centre stage, including a wander around post-ceremony. We ended up needing to cut it down to just a few moments outside due to rain, but it gave us so much confidence to enjoy the day and be in the moment. We had so many comments from friends and family about how wonderful Solen was, and witnessed ourselves her ability to bring a smile to our faces. And the photos themselves – we really can’t express just how impressed we are with them. We knew we would love every one, but the sheer happiness we get from looking through them is on a level we weren’t prepared for. Our couples’ photos are so full of laughter and love and transport us right back to the moment. Trying to decide which ones to have framed is a lovely problem to have. But it’s the ones of our friends and family that we can’t get over. Solen caught the spirit of the day and everyone involved so faithfully and we will treasure that forever. It’s been a month since we got married, and we can’t wait to share them! Thank you so much Solen for being part of our day and giving us the most incredible photographs to remember it by.”
– Rebecca & Adam
